Product Overview

The DS1780E+ is a CPU peripheral monitor in 24 pin TSSOP package. This highly integrated system instrumentation monitor is ideal for use in personal computers or any microprocessor based system. It monitors ambient temperature, six power supply voltages and speed of two fans. Fan speed can also be controlled with the use of an internal 8bit DAC. All measurements are internally converted to a digital format for easy processing by the CPU. The DS1780 can be reset to its default power-up state via a remote reset function with internal debounce and delay. It has an interrupt that can be programmed to become active when any of functions monitoring by DS1780 falls out of specification. For board level testability, an internal NAND TREE function simplifies the system design. A chassis intrusion input is featured to enhance system security. The DS1780 power supply range from 2.8V to 5.75V allows for monitoring of parameters for 3V or 5V systems.

  • Direct to digital temperature sensor requires no external components or user calibration
  • Two fan speed sensors
  • Programming and data readout are accessed via a simple 2-wire interface with 2bit addressability
  • Intrusion detect for security (detects when chassis lid has been removed even if power is off)
  • Remote system reset
  • System interrupt availability on all monitored functions
